The Advantages of an Electric Fireplace

An electric fireplace is a great alternative for those who want the look of a fireplace without the cost and hassle of a wood fire. The heat is emitted through a heating coil which is used in conjunction with fans to push warm humid air into the room.

Many models can be wall-mounted by homeowners without the need for a professional. Others are built into bookshelves, TV stands or entertainment centers.

It is simple to install

If you want to add an inviting ambience to your home, an electric fireplace can be a good option. These units produce heat with electricity, which makes them much easier to set up than traditional gas fireplaces. They also require no venting, making them more secure than wood burning fireplaces. They're also a great choice for homes without traditional fireplaces, such as mobile homes or apartments.

To install an electric fireplace, you must first find the best location in your room. Then, determine the opening of your fireplace or consult the installation guide from the manufacturer to determine the dimensions of the insert you need. Then, you need to find the correct mounting brackets. Use a spirit-level gauge to make sure that they are exactly on the wall. Once you have the brackets set then plug the fireplace into them and connect the wire. Then, you can relax in your new fireplace!

It is secure

Electric fireplaces are safe to use in the night, unlike gas or wood fireplaces that release carbon monoxide fumes. It doesn't produce dangerous fumes or harmful smoke, so you can rest peacefully without worrying about your family's health. Electric fireplaces are safe when they are operated correctly and if the user adheres to all guidelines and instructions. In general, it is best to keep the space around the fireplace free of flammable items such as furniture, clothing drapes, bedding, and other items. Do not use extension cords close to your fireplace. This could cause overheating and power fluctuations, which may result in a fire. Disconnecting the fireplace when not being used will also decrease the amount of energy consumed and also help to prevent overheating.

Electric fireplaces are not designed to produce real flames, but to mimic the appearance. Instead, they employ LED lights, video images, or mist to create the illusion of flames. Certain models employ water vapor to create the illusion of smoke. They're more realistic than traditional fire places and do not require maintenance.

It is easy to clean

If you have an electric fireplace, it's important to clean it regularly. This is especially true when you are using it frequently. This will ensure it looks new and help to stop the build-up of dust. Before you begin cleaning, turn off the fireplace and ensure it's cool. This will help prevent electrical shocks. It is also a good idea to wear safety glasses or goggles to shield your eyes from any particles that might break during the cleaning process.

The first step to clean an electric fireplace is to dust all surfaces. This should be done using the use of a soft, lint-free cloth. You can also use a vacuum cleaner with a brush attachment to remove dust from corners and crevices. Then, prepare a solution made of water and dishwashing soap.
